Front bumper cover

I was sanding my front bumper cover down to fix the spider cracks and discovered the cracks are in the bumper cover itself and someone repaired parts of it with body filler. I was looking for a new cover online. Does anyone know if a 2003 Boxster S bumper cover will bolt up to a 200 base

You can also use a 1999-2001 996 front bumper cover. Direct bolt up. A 2001 996 turbo bumper will not work.
